General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.147(c)(4)(i): Procedures were not developed, documented and utilized for the control of potentially hazardous energy when employees were engaged in activities covered by this section: H. S. Crocker Company, Inc., did not develop written specific lockout procedures. Maintenance is performed on various machinery including, printing presses and die cutters. Abatement documentation is required for this item in accordance with 29 CFR 1903.19(d).

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.212(a)(1): One or more methods of machine guarding was not provided to protect the operator and other employees in the machine area from hazards such as those created by point of operation, ingoing nip points, rotating parts, flying chips and sparks: In the machine shop, the LeBlonde lathe was not equipped with a chuck/chip guard. Abatement certification is required for this item in accordance with 29 CFR 1903.19(c).
